As a 5th-era Gilbane family member, Dan joined the enterprise in 2005. He served in numerous management roles before becoming the senior vice chairman of the Southwest department, where he became responsible for sales, marketing, operations, and methods. He focused on supplying quality offerings and artistry that promote robust patron relationships, consumer delight, repeat clients, and new commercial enterprise growth.

An active member of the Houston network, Dan serves on the YES Prep Public Schools forums, the Greater Houston Partnership, Houston Methodist’s President’s Leadership Council, and the Associated General Contractors. He is energetic in the real property network and is a member of the Urban Land Institute. He serves as the 2019 Campaign Chair for the United Way of Greater Houston and is the executive sponsor for Gilbane’s Hispanic worker aid institution.
Dan holds a bachelor’s degree in International Relations from Brown University and an MBA from Harvard Business School. He lives with his wife, Eleanor, and three children in Houston, Texas.
